G'day fellas. After weeks of not being able to get out in a boat my luck changed today.

I've got the bro inlaw and sister inlaw up for a few days and he happens to know a bloke that works at Bluefin.

So we headed out in schmick custom boat for a session in the broadwater. We got out a little late around 8am and were greeted with flat waters, no wind and not to much boat/jet ski traffic.

We set up a few drifts past currigee, got a few hits and then I hooked up to the first fish of the morning. A 47cm flatty taken on a 3" Flash J. Daniel (Bro Inlaw) was next off the mark boating a slimy little pike. Liam then picked up a small flatty, we had a few drifts past there with plenty of hits and misses and a couple of small fish boated.

After this we moved over to Crab island and drifted north with the tide. We saw huge schools of bait fish and butter bream with a few large bream hanging around the schools, they didn't take a liking to the lures though. A couple more pike were boated through this area as well as Liam landing the biggest puffer fish I've ever seen. This thing looked a like a soccer ball with spikes.

After, we headed over to one of Liam's never fails and sure enough after a few lure changes we were rewarded with a few more lizards going 48-52. I then decided to throw on an Atomic prong in white. Second cast and I got a solid thump, I leaned back on the rod to set the hook but the line went slack, so I let the plastic rest on the bottom for a few seconds and gave it one small hop and BANG. Line started screaming from the reel :woohoo: (this is a sound that has seemed to have alluded me while flatty fiahing for a while) after and intense 10 minute fight and the feeling of the leader rubbing on the fishes mouth the net slid under my prize. A lovely, well conditioned 71cm flatty.

I have a couple of clips from today but at present I'm editing them but will put them up as soon as they're ready. Unfortunately my go pro battery died just before landing the big girl, but I got most of the fight, and a couple of stills as well.
